Road Tripping Around The World

Road tripping, or motoring, is enjoyed all over the world. Although the history of road trips may be different in each country, the idea, concept, and methods remain relatively unchanged worldwide. For this reason, it can be fairly easy to conduct a road trip on foreign soils. Unlike some other methods of travel, cars allow travelers to customize their trip and set their own pace.
